  • 41 street

    [stri:t] n
    1) ( road) Straße f;
    in the \street auf der Straße; stockex nach Börsenschluss;
    on the \streets auf den Straßen;
    I live in [or (Am) on] King S\street ich wohne in der King Street;
    our daughter lives just across the \street from us unsere Tochter wohnt direkt gegenüber [auf der anderen Straßenseite];
    the \streets were deserted die Straßen waren wie leer gefegt;
    the \streets are quiet at the moment im Moment ist es ruhig auf den Straßen;
    cobbled [or (Am) cobblestone] \street Straße f mit Kopfsteinpflaster;
    main \street Hauptstraße f;
    narrow \street enge Straße;
    shopping \street Einkaufsstraße f;
    side \street Seitenstraße f;
    to cross the \street die Straße überqueren;
    to line the \street die Straße säumen;
    to roam the \streets durch die Straßen ziehen;
    to take to the \streets auf die Straße gehen (a. fig)
    to walk down the \street die Straße hinuntergehen
    2) + sing/ pl vb ( residents) Straße f;
    the whole \street die ganze Straße
    PHRASES:
    the man/woman in the \street der Mann/die Frau von der Straße;
    to be \streets ahead [of sb/sth] ( Brit) [jdm/etw] meilenweit voraus sein;
    to not be in the same \street as sb ( Brit) ( fam) an jdn nicht herankönnen;
    to be on [or walk] the \streets ( be homeless) obdachlos sein, auf der Straße sitzen ( fam) ( be a prostitute) auf den Strich gehen ( fam)
    to be [right] up sb's \street genau das Richtige für jdn sein;
    carpentry isn't really up my \street das Schreinern ist eigentlich nicht so ganz mein Fall;
    to dance in the \street[s] einen Freudentanz aufführen, [ganz] aus dem Häuschen sein
